## Releases

Heads up: Ledgerloop's currency conversion had a long-running rounding bug where half-cent remainders got dropped instead of banker's-rounded, so totals drifted on big batches. Release 3.2 fixes this, but it means every release now runs a reconciliation check against the golden fixtures before tagging. Don't skip it, even for hotfixes — Marta will notice. When the fixtures pass, sign the release tarball so the publish pipeline accepts it. The signing key for release builds is the following.

release key, kawif-hawep: bky13_X7TGuRG4Zu4ZJ

Ticket: Staging env misconfigured for Siftgate bloom filter

The bloom layer in front of the Pellet KV store is rejecting all lookups in staging because the env file was copied from the dev template without credentials. False-positive tuning values are fine; only the auth line is missing. To unblock the weekly demo, the Pellet admission secret must be set on the following line.

env line for yaguf-fajop: LEDGER_TOKEN13=fb08984397349

## Deployment

Formulary evaluates user-supplied formulas inside a seccomp-restricted worker pool, one interpreter per request. Release builds must ship with the sandbox profile baked in; the manager pipeline refuses unsigned profiles. Memory and CPU ceilings are enforced per evaluation, and escapes trip an automatic rollback. Before promoting a release, verify the sandbox settings match the approved baseline shown below.

deployment values, yahag-tawef:
ZORWYN_HOST=zorwyn.tolvaqlabs.internal
ZORWYN_PORT=9300

**Handover: search relevance tuning — Quillsea**

Picking up from Dario's work on the Quillsea relevance pass. Recall on long-tail queries improved after the synonym expansion change, but head queries regressed slightly; boost weights likely need another round. The A/B split stays at 10% until the Pellmont metrics dashboard stabilizes. Don't touch the stemmer settings — that experiment concluded. For the sync, note that the candidate ranker is currently running with the values below.

settings of tagef-bawif:
DRUIX_HOST=druix.zemvarlabs.internal
DRUIX_PORT=8000